Heraclia africana (Butler, 1875a)

COMMON NAME(S): African False Tiger.

SYNONYM(S): Eusemia meretrix Westwood, 1881a; Xanthospilopteryx fatima Kirby, 1891; Xanthospilopteryx flava Jordan, 1913.

IUCN STATUS: Not Evaluated (NE).

DISTRIBUTION: Kenya, Malawi, Mozambique, Namibia, South Africa, Tanzania, Uganda, Zambia, Zimbabwe.

LOCALITY IN ZAMBIA: ‘Lusaka’, in Lusaka Province.

LARVAL HOSTPLANT(S): Larval foodplants include two species from the plant family Vitaceae namely, Cyphostemma cirrhosum (Thunb.) Desc. ex Wild & R.B.Drumm. and Rhoicissus tridentata (L.f.) Wild & R.B.Drumm. (African Moths 2019).

SOURCES: African Moths 2019; De Prins & De Prins 2022; Hampson 1910c.
